Transaction 5976a464af0dec46cb115061faefa56a8ff514672111f2d8ac9715c67724bd58
1 Input
1 Output
-
5976a464af0dec46cb115061faefa56a8ff514672111f2d8ac9715c67724bd58:0
- value
- 521432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abb3d2d525c3f4bd099dffb2610f4e1547e94257 OP_EQUAL
- address
- 3HLtthxtC4rWRAUsWt9os6Nsb37ur5Y5vS